logo

Output aeeaaf752c9c61c24092c4b41e7f837fd424cf926bbb82978d3c021f4052fccf:0

value
2528747361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 186d871c5d26f6fda0374e9e20dc454e93e9f1b6 OP_EQUAL
address
33vBMGfwXMALWJmb4NgbGJyQ3mW9BSayHf
transaction
aeeaaf752c9c61c24092c4b41e7f837fd424cf926bbb82978d3c021f4052fccf